Dundas Valley Medical Centre was founded nearly 40 years ago in a house on the border of Dundas Valley and Telopea by Dr Kelvin Lo and Dr Leslie Nighjoy – two doctors who had a real heart for the community. Their patient-centred approach and dedication has been admired by the many patients who have attended the practice. The photo above is of the house that they worked in over these many years.
Dr Peter Chong joined the team in 2012 and soon after the team gradually grew in size to what it is today.
In September 2015, the practice relocated to our current address – a shop across the road in Telopea – freshly fitted out but still aiming to retain that friendly homely feel of the old surgery. From February 2016, our surgery has expanded to being affiliated with our other practice in Lidcombe (Quality Health Medical Centre), which aims to offer the same philosophy and quality of medicine.
